Why Live in Firebaugh

Firebaugh, CA, nestled between San Jose and Fresno in rural Fresno County, is an agricultural community with a rich history dating back to 1854. This tranquil city offers expansive views of fields dotted with metal barns and silos, reflecting its origins as a San Joaquin River ferry crossing and sheep shearing operation. Firebaugh's economy is primarily driven by agriculture, though transportation companies and healthcare services also play significant roles. The Valley Health Team and Firebaugh Community Health Center provide local healthcare services, with Memorial Hospital Los Banos located 30 miles northwest. Residents enjoy outdoor activities at Maldonado Park, which features baseball diamonds, basketball courts, a skate park, and a seasonal splash pad. Riverside Park offers scenic river views, a disc golf course, and a paved walking path leading to the Firebaugh Rodeo Grounds. Housing options include three-bedroom single-family homes built between 1970 and 1999, manufactured housing, and multi-unit properties, with a nearly even split between owners and renters. Firebaugh-Las Deltas Unified School District serves over 2,400 students, offering expanded learning programs and career technical pathways. Dining options are limited but include local favorites like Giant Burger and Don Pepe’s Taqueria. For more extensive shopping and dining, residents travel to nearby Madera, Los Banos, or Fresno. Firebaugh is safer than the national average, with property crime rates nearly half the national average. However, the city faces natural disaster risks such as wildfires, flooding, and severe air pollution.
